About Flat 8
Flat 8 is a two-bedroom mid-terrace house in Newcastle Upon Tyne (NE1 5SF). It has a recorded floor area of 47 m² (around 509 sq ft), construction records dating it to before 1900 and council tax band A. It is a listed building, which means external alterations are tightly controlled but it may qualify for heritage tax reliefs. At 47 m² this is the 5th smallest of 7 units on EPC record in the building, where floor areas span 34–52 m². The building's EPC ratings span E to C, with this unit at the bottom. On EPC score it ranks last in the building (41 versus a best of 79). The latest certificate (December 2008) shows an E (score 41), well below the UK norm with real room to improve. Main heating runs on electricity. The latest certificate is from December 2008, so improvements made since then won't be reflected.
It lags the bulk of the postcode on energy efficiency (less efficient than 80% of similar EPCs). Last sold in July 2012, so it's been off the market for around 14 years. Across 2000–2012, sale prices on this property compounded at 4.2% per year. Today's modelled estimate of £125,000 is 19% above the 2012 sale price.
